Hartcoat Sideshow

Hartcoat Sideshow is a collaborative and dynamic display of performers, visual artists and creative practitioners exploring ideas of group dynamic, and the spectacle.
The event will be held on the 8th of November at H-Block Kelvin Grove QUT, and be in the format of a mini carnival existing as a collaborative work in the Vis Arts graduate group show. 
The idea is that the Hartcoat Sideshow will be a physical incarnation of Hartcoat’s key ideals to create opportunities for emerging artists to exhibit their work.

We are calling for proposals for games, contraptions, events or performances that follow the loose theme of “the carnival”.  We will basically have the run of an entire car-park (about 20m squared) with a big tent in the centre.  Works can be held within or around the tent, but are asked to be considerate of the audience attending the show.

Artists can run their own ideas/projects, or contribute to elements in existing ideas listed below:

    • A carnival-type dart game, where the audience wins a distorted stuffed toy. (For this project we need people to construct the distorted toys)
    • Roving performers doing tricks or mini acts
